Job Description:
Summary: Removes excess material from castings with an oxy fuel
cutting torch. Once trained, this position will work our 1st shift,
which is normally 6:30 AM - 3 PM
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following. Other
duties may be assigned.
* Uses a oxy-fuel cutting torch to remove all risers, gates, and
fins safely, efficiently, and without gouging the casting, cutting
up to 24" thick sections.
* Communicates to supervision quality and equipment problems.
* Inspects equipment daily.
* Follows job work instructions and training matrix, where
applicable.

Work Environment:
The work environment characteristics described here are
representative of those an employee encounters while performing the
ess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be
made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the
essential functions.
While performing the duties of this Job, the employee is regularly
exposed to work near moving mechanical parts; fumes or airborne
particles; extreme heat (non-weather) and vibration. The employee
is frequently exposed to toxic or caustic chemicals and extreme
cold. The employee is occasionally exposed to wet or humid
conditions; outdoor weather conditions. The employee may be exposed
to risk of electrical shock and risk of radiation. The noise level
in the work environment is usually very loud.
Physical Demands:
The physical demands described here are representative of those
that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the
ess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be
made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the
essential functions.
The employee must occasionally lift and/or move up to 50 pounds.
Specific vision abilities required by this job include Close
vision, Distance vision, Peripheral vision, Depth perception and
ability to adjust focus. While performing the duties of this Job,
the employee is regularly required to stand; reach with hands and
arms; st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l; talk or hear and taste or
smell. The employee is occasionally required to walk. The employee
must be able to hold onto a torch for long periods of time and be
able to wear a full-face fresh air helmet.
